THIRTY SECONDS TO MARS Reimagine “The Kill” in Intimate Acoustic Form


Celebrating two decades of A Beautiful Lie, Thirty Seconds To Mars return with an evocative reinterpretation of their classic track, “The Kill (Acoustic),” featured on the upcoming 20-year anniversary edition of the album, out March 27th. The official music video offers a reflective lens into the band’s journey, combining the intimacy of the acoustic performance with a narrative of growth, struggle, and artistic evolution.

Stripping back the original’s bombastic rock production, “The Kill (Acoustic)” emphasizes raw emotion, with Jared Leto’s vocals conveying vulnerability and introspection. The arrangement’s simplicity—delicate guitar work paired with subtle atmospheric elements—allows the song’s lyrical depth to take center stage, offering fans a fresh yet faithful perspective on a beloved classic.

The music video complements this reinterpretation, providing a cinematic introspection into the band’s 20-year history. Through archival imagery, behind-the-scenes moments, and contemplative visuals, viewers are invited to experience the milestones, challenges, and triumphs that have shaped Thirty Seconds To Mars into the iconic act they are today.

With this release, the band bridges nostalgia with renewed emotional resonance, proving that even two decades later, their music remains powerful and relevant. “The Kill (Acoustic)” stands as both a celebration of the past and a testament to the enduring spirit of Thirty Seconds To Mars, offering a moment of reflection for longtime fans and newcomers alike.

This anniversary edition promises to honor the legacy of A Beautiful Lie while highlighting the band’s evolution, making the acoustic “The Kill” a centerpiece of the commemorative experience.
